Experience the next generation of high-fidelity acoustic simulation and synthetic audio data generation at CES 2026
At CES we will present the Treble SDK, a cloud based programmatic interface that exposes our hybrid wave based and geometrical acoustics engine at scale. The SDK enables generation of physically accurate spatial audio data, high throughput evaluation of audio machine learning systems and automated virtual prototyping of audio hardware. Visitors will be able to examine how full band wave based simulation combined with phased geometrical methods unlocks new engineering workflows across speech technologies, adaptive audio, product acoustics and spatial audio research, supported by massively parallel cloud execution and advanced source, receiver and scene modeling.
Why visit us
Treble delivers acoustic simulation capabilities that have not previously been accessible at scale in voice technology, consumer audio, automotive acoustics and AR or VR. Our hybrid wave based and geometrical engine captures diffraction, interference, modal behaviour and high frequency propagation with real world accuracy, enabling engineering teams to model acoustic conditions that are difficult or expensive to measure. This unlocks new workflows in data generation, algorithm development and virtual prototyping, replacing slow physical measurements with large scale, physics grounded simulation. At CES our team will demonstrate how the Treble SDK integrates into existing R&D pipelines across these industries and how this capability reshapes the way audio systems are designed, tuned and validated.
